ALT

ALT or alanine aminotransferase is an intracellular enzyme that breaks down keto acids and amino acids. It belongs to the group of aminotransferase enzymes, which are the main enzymes of protein metabolism in the human body. In addition, aminotransferases bind protein and carbohydrate metabolism. A biochemical blood test for the level of concentration of this enzyme is a marker in the diagnosis of many diseases.

The largest amount of the enzyme alanine aminotransferase is found in the cells of the liver, muscles, kidneys, heart, pancreas. In the case when these organs are damaged, a significant amount of ALT comes out of the destroyed cells, due to which the level of this enzyme in the blood increases.

Indications for the appointment of this analysis is the diagnosis of certain liver diseases, skeletal muscles, myocardium. Besides, biochemical analysis alanine aminotransferase is prescribed for monitoring patients with viral hepatitis, examination of blood donors.

Elevated ALT

A high level of ALT indicates the pathological conditions of those organs in the cells of which its content is greatest. The main reasons for the increase in this enzyme are the following diseases:

  1. Liver disease. Most often, these diseases include hepatitis A, B, C, E, D. In addition, it can be cirrhosis of the liver (a disease associated with the death of liver cells), liver cancer, fatty liver (a disease in which liver cells are replaced by fat cells ), obstructive jaundice. Usually, the degree of increase in the content of ALT in the blood is proportional to the severity of the liver pathology. Often, an increase in the content of this enzyme appears before all other symptoms of the disease. With hepatitis in the blood, in addition to an increase in the content of ALT, as a rule, an increase in the content of the blood pigment bilirubin is also observed.
  2. myocardial infarction. This disease is characterized by the death of some parts of the heart muscle. As a result, an increased amount of the enzyme alanine aminotransferase is released into the blood.
  3. Heart failure, myocarditis(inflammation of the heart muscle), myodystrophy (progressive muscle dystrophy), myositis (inflammatory process in skeletal muscles). In these diseases, due to the destruction of the cells of the heart muscle and other muscle groups, the concentration of this enzyme in the blood increases.
  4. Acute pancreatitis- inflammation in the pancreas.
  5. Burns and major injuries resulting in muscle damage.
  6. hypoxia(lack of oxygen in brain tissues), shock.

Decreased ALT

A reduced concentration of alanine aminotransferase in a blood test occurs with an acute deficiency in the body of vitamin B6 and serious illnesses liver, in which the number of hepatocytes producing ALT is greatly reduced. Most often this occurs with cirrhosis of the liver.

AST - enzyme functions and assignment for analysis

AST, or aspartate aminotransferase, is involved in protein metabolism. It performs many important functions, one of which is participation in the construction of cell membranes, the synthesis of amino acids.

Helps to know the level of AST blood biochemistry. This enzyme is considered specific. Its increase indicates disturbances in certain tissues in which it is found in the greatest amount. The largest amount of AST is found in tissues, muscles, and nervous tissue. This is due to the fact that metabolic processes in these tissues are more active, and the cells need constant renewal and maintenance of their structure.

As soon as the cells of these organs begin to break down, the enzyme is actively released into the blood, so its level in the blood serum rises. If the cells remain intact and function normally, then the level of AST remains at a minimum level.

AST is found in the body in two forms: cytoplasmic and mitochondrial.

To release a cytoplasmic enzyme into the blood, it is enough to destroy the outer shell of the cell, therefore, an increased level of this form of AST indicates less serious damage to cells and tissues than an increased level of mitochondrial AST, the release of which requires total destruction of the cell and its organelles.

Since a large amount of the AST enzyme is located in the tissues of the liver and heart, its elevated level most often indicates the pathology of these organs, although it is necessary to assess the state of the body taking into account all indicators.

Possible Complications

A directly elevated level of AST has no complications, since this is a consequence of the disease, the body's reaction to it, and not the disease itself and not its cause. Pathological conditions that cause elevated blood levels can lead to severe and complications.

Among the most common complications of cardiac and hepatic pathologies with increased level AST are the following:

  • Acute heart failure. Myocardial infarction with severe course may be complicated by heart failure, which is expressed in a violation of the contractility of the heart muscle. At the same time, the patient feels shortness of breath or suffocation, a strong cough, he has cyanotic skin, foaming from the mouth, wheezing in the chest. In the event of such a serious complication, delay in medical care fraught with death.
  • Hepatic coma. Hepatic coma can occur with active cell death in viral hepatitis. Symptoms of hepatic coma are not always associated with pain, it often begins with a feeling of anxiety, an unstable emotional state, and apathy. Then there is confusion, tremor of the hands, and finally, elevated body temperature, jaundice, complete loss of consciousness.
  • Myocardial rupture. One of the most common complications of myocardial infarction. The severity of the complication depends on where the rupture occurred. Most often, there is a rupture of the wall of the left ventricle, less often - the right ventricle, and even less often - the interventricular septum. The main symptoms are sharp pain, loss of consciousness, slow pulse, suffocation. In case of myocardial rupture, urgent surgical intervention is necessary, otherwise a fatal outcome is inevitable.
  • Aneurysm of the heart. An aneurysm can also appear as a consequence of myocardial infarction. It manifests itself in the thinning and bulging of the wall of the heart muscle. Most often, such a consequence needs surgical treatment because the aneurysm can burst at any time.
  • Liver cancer. It often develops against the background of cirrhosis. Liver cells are reborn, which can lead to the formation of malignant tumors.

Alanine aminotransferase (also ALT, ALT) is a protein enzyme that is responsible for the transport of certain molecules and the acceleration of biochemical processes involving amino acids.

ALTs are found mostly in the cells of organ tissues. In healthy people, ALT cannot be elevated in the blood, since if ALT is released into the blood, it is likely that it is occurring in some part of the body. serious illness.

Most of all, ALT is found in the liver, and it can also be found in the kidneys, heart muscle, nerve connections, and lungs. Damage to these organs and tissues can cause an increase in ALT in the blood.

Optimal value in the body

This parameter is measured in units per liter of blood. ALT is age dependent in childhood, and in adults it is gender dependent.

Children under one year old: no more than 55 units / l

Children 1-3 years old: no more than 34 units / l

Children 3-6 years old: no more than 30 units / l

Children 6-12 years old: no more than 39 units / l

Men: no more than 45 units / l

Women: no more than 35 units / l

The norm in this case is not a strict and only possible value, but an approximate evaluation criterion. In some laboratories, the devices may have a different degree of sensitivity, which means that the results of the analysis should be discussed with the attending physician of this medical institution.

Alanine aminotransferase is elevated, what does this mean?

According to the degree of difference between the actual result of the analysis and the value taken as the norm, they distinguish:

  • Slight increase (by 200-500%);
  • Moderate increase (up to 1000%, that is, 10 times more);
  • Pronounced (more than 10 times the norm).

The second and third stages most likely indicate that elevated ALT in the blood is a consequence of the disease, and the third case occurs in those patients who have already begun serious destruction of the organ.

Causes and diseases when ALT is elevated in the blood

Since the enzyme under study may be retained in various bodies, it may indicate problems with their health. Consider what it means "ALT increased" in each case.

  1. Liver disease

The largest amount of ALT, as already mentioned, is located here, it is not surprising that this analysis is recognized in time to notice and cure liver diseases.

  • Steatosis

The accumulation of fat in the liver cells affects the fact that ALT is increased by 2 times. But if the disease condition worsens to steatohepatitis, ALT will increase much more, and bilirubin levels will also increase.

  • Hepatitis

If ALT is elevated in the blood test, and the symptoms of the disease have not yet appeared, it may be from hepatitis A. Usually, the symptoms are delayed, and due to the timely donation of blood for analysis, the recovery process can be accelerated.

With hepatitis B and C, ALT increases even 100 times, since the toxic effect of the virus common in the liver is especially great on its cells.

Chronic hepatitis causes an increase in ALT during an exacerbation, but the increase usually occurs no more than 3-4 times.

Other symptoms of hepatitis include pain and discomfort in the right side, under the ribs, a bitter taste in the mouth, yellowing of the skin, mucous membranes, whites of the eyes, and impaired stool.

  • cirrhosis

A very high ALT in the blood may not be observed in cirrhosis. ALT will rise, but 1-5 times the norm. This is due to the replacement of liver cells with connective tissue.

  • Liver cancer

Usually malignant tumors in the liver appear in people with hepatitis. The level, how much alanine aminotransferase is increased, helps to make a decision on further surgical treatment of cancer. For example, if ALT is very high, the operation has a great risk of complications.

  • autoimmune hepatitis

A disease more common among women than among men. To clarify its presence or absence, the doctor may prescribe a biopsy.

  1. A heart

Diseases of the heart, or rather the heart muscle, are primarily indicated by another analysis - AST, but along with it, ALT is also used for diagnosis.

  • myocardial infarction

The death of a part of the heart muscle, as a result of which a certain amount of AST and ALT enters the bloodstream. If the analysis of AST is greatly increased and alanine transaminase is increased by 5 times, the reasons should be sought in the possibility of myocardial infarction.

Other symptoms: sharp pain in the region of the heart, radiating to the left upper side of the body, the pain can last half an hour or more, the patient has shortness of breath, dizziness, panic fear of death, weakness.

  • Myocarditis

As with other diseases of the heart muscle, myocarditis cannot be established solely on the basis that ALT is elevated. The reasons for this may be varied. Often, to clarify the diagnosis, an analysis of AST is also considered and the de Ritis coefficient is calculated equal to ALT / AST.

Symptoms include shortness of breath, weakness, fatigue of the patient.

Heart failure, rheumatic heart disease, recent heart surgery can also cause an increase in ALT in the blood.

  1. Pancreas
  • pancreatitis

The disease can occur in acute or chronic form. An increase in ALT indicates the stage of exacerbation. It is advisable for people with pancreatitis to donate blood regularly for ALT analysis.

What it is

Alanine and aspartate aminotransferase are enzymes that are present in the cells of visceral organs and blood plasma. They take an active part in the exchange of individual amino acids (alanine and aspartic acid). An increase or decrease in ALT and AST in the blood indicates the destruction of functional cells due to a necrotic, cancerous or inflammatory process.

Alanine transferase is found predominantly in hepatocytes (liver cells) and myocardiocytes (heart cells), but is also present in the kidneys, skeletal muscle, and pancreas. Its main function is the transfer of the amino group of alanine acid to ketoglutaric acid with the further formation of pyruvic and glutamic acids, which play an important role in the biochemical reactions of the body.

Aspartic transferase is found in hepatocytes, cardiomyocytes, muscle and kidney tissues, etc. Its function is the formation of aspartate and ketoglutarate by transferring the amino acid group. The metabolism of these acids is necessary for the implementation of the urea cycle and the endogenous formation of glucose.

Aspartic transferase is present in the same tissues as the first enzyme, but due to a different functional purpose found in them in different concentrations. This means that not only the nature of the deviations from the norm, but also the ratio between AST and ALT helps to make a correct diagnosis for violations in biochemistry.

Analysis for AST and ALT is mandatory when checking liver function (liver tests), investigating the causes of dyspepsia, diagnosing the condition of the myocardium, muscle fibers and other internal organs.

Norms and deviations

Norms of ALT and AST in the blood differ depending on gender and age. A change in the normal concentration of enzymes is noted with large sports loads and bearing a child.

Due to the large number of influencing factors, a slight deviation upward or downward from the norm is not a pathology.

In adults

In patients over 18 years of age, AST and ALT are normally:

  1. Alanine aminotransferase: up to 31 U / l in adult women outside the period of bearing a child, up to 32 U / l in pregnant women, up to 45 U / l in men.
  2. Aspartate aminotransferase: up to 31 U / l in non-pregnant women, up to 30 U / l in expectant mothers, up to 47 U / l in men.

Reference values ​​depend on the sensitivity of the laboratory equipment. Normal level AST and ALT in the blood are given in the analysis form next to the patient results column.

A valuable diagnostic indicator is the ratio of ALT to AST: normally it is 0.77. More common is the Ritis coefficient, which is the inverse ratio (AST to ALT): its value ranges from 0.88 to 1.72 (1.3 s possible deviations no more than 0.42).
In other words, ideally, if AST is 1.5 times higher than ALT.

Causes and symptoms of an increase

The reason for the abnormal concentration of alanine and aspartic aminotransferases are pathological processes in the internal organs, proceeding with the massive decay of functional cells. The amount of excess enzyme content indicates the nature of the course of the disease and the localization of the lesion.

Small deviations in the blood test for ALT and AST are allowed only with normal other blood parameters: urea (2.8-7.2), bilirubin (3.4-17.1), alkaline phosphatase (up to 38 in women, up to 55 in men) and albumin (32-52). They are measured in mmol/l, µmol/l, U/l and g/l, respectively.

Increased only AST

An isolated increase in the blood test for AST is observed under the following conditions:

  • acute myocardial infarction (increase in enzyme concentration);
  • myocarditis;
  • angina pectoris of high severity;
  • acute heart failure;
  • rehabilitation after cardiological operations;
  • recent angiocardiography;
  • thrombosis of the pulmonary artery;
  • acute rheumatic heart disease;
  • cardiomyopathy of various etiologies.

A change in the biochemical index may be accompanied by shortness of breath, chest pain, cyanosis of the lips and other symptoms characteristic of heart pathologies.

In addition, an increase in AST with normal ALT can talk about destruction muscle mass. The reason for this may be the problem of digestion of proteins, difficulties in obtaining energy. As a result, muscles are destroyed as a source of energy.

Elevated only ALT

A pathological blood test for ALT is observed in diseases such as:

  • acute and chronic viral hepatitis;
  • alcohol and toxic injury hepatocytes, incl. medications (sulfonamides, antibiotics, NSAIDs, psychotropic drugs, cytostatics, etc.);
  • oncological processes in the liver;
  • fatty hepatosis;
  • pancreatitis;
  • infectious mononucleosis, complicated by damage to the spleen and liver;
  • burns;
  • shock etc.

An isolated increase in the concentration of alanine aminotransferase is observed in rare cases. Most often, in lesions of the liver and other areas with a high concentration of the enzyme, an increase in the content of both transferases is observed with a sharp decrease in the Ritis coefficient.

An increase in ALT may be accompanied by pain in the right and left hypochondria, a feeling of heaviness in the abdomen, yellowness of the skin and whites of the eyes, darkening of the urine, loss of strength, weakness and dyspeptic symptoms (diarrhea, flatulence, appetite disorders). On the early stages hepatitis without jaundice, a change in the concentration of alanine enzyme may be the only sign of the disease.

joint enhancement

A simultaneous increase in ALT and AST is typical for the following conditions:

  • gestosis of pregnant women;
  • extensive injuries and inflammatory processes in muscle tissue;
  • active heavy sports;
  • diseases of the kidneys, liver and heart.

An increase in the concentration of transaminases can be observed in children and adolescents during the period of active growth.
